Types of asset groups in Asset Explorer:
Static Group: Add the relevant assets to the group manually.
Dynamic Group: Assets matching certain criteria are added to the group automatically.

Create Asset Group         

  1. Go to Assets > Groups > Add New Group.
  2. Enter a unique group name. This is mandatory.
  3. Describe the group.
  4. Select the group type: static or dynamic.
  5. Click Save.

 Add Components to Groups         

 Static Group 

  1. Go to the component list view, and select the components using the check boxes.
  2. Click Actions > Add to Group.
  3. You can choose a static group from the drop-down, or create a new static group by enabling the respective radio button.
  4. Click Save.

Dynamic Group  

Components matching certain criteria are added to the dynamic group automatically. For that, you must define the component criteria while creating the group.
